Caldison 250mg Tablet belongs to the therapeutic classification of Vitamin Supplements, Calcium Supplements. The primary composition for this medicine is Elemental calcium 250 MG, Vitamin D3 125 IU.

Warnings: Let your doctor know if you are allergic to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's or its inActive components.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's is not recommended if you have hypercalcaemia (high calcium levels), hypervitaminosis D (high vitamin D levels), and malabsorption syndrome (difficulty absorbing nutrition from food). Brief your medical history to the doctor if you have any heart/kidney/liver/blood vessel diseases, kidney stones, achlorhydria (little or no stomach acid), low levels of bile, and phosphate imbalance before starting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's. Consult your doctor before taking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Drinking alcohol can affect calcium absorption; therefore, it is advised to limit the alcohol intake while using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's.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's is safe to use in children only when prescribed by the doctor.
Medicine Interaction: Caldison 250 mg Tablet 10's may interact with drugs treating high cholesterol levels (cholestyramine, colestipol), antibiotics (doxycycline, ciprofloxacin, levofloxacin, penicillin, neomycin, and chloramphenicol), anti-cancer drugs (estramustine), drugs treating bone loss (alendronate), thyroid hormone (levothyroxine), weight-loss drugs (orlistat), fits medicines (phenobarbital), mineral oils, water pills (furosemide, etacrynic acid), and heart-related medicines (digitoxin).
